KUKA, founded in 1898 by Johann Josef Keller and Jakob Knappich, is a global automation corporation with a revenue of around € 3.3 billion and roughly 14,000 employees. The company is headquartered in Augsburg, Germany. As one of the world’s leading suppliers of intelligent automation solutions, KUKA offers customers everything they need from a single source: from robots and cells to fully automated systems and their networking in markets such as automotive, electronics, metal & plastic, consumer goods, e-commerce/retail and healthcare.
Since 2013, robots have been lending humans a hand – thanks to KUKA. The LBR iiwa is the world’s first series-produced sensitive, and therefore, human-robot-collaboration (HRC) compatible robot in the world. With the LBR iiwa (intelligent industrial work assistant), the success story continues: It is suitable for applications in both industrial series production and environments with unstructured workspaces.

Fun fact: The brand name KUKA was created from the initial letters of the telegram abbreviation ‘Keller und Knappich Augsburg’.
